Calling on the knowledge of the .ORG

I need to send some stuff to Jersey and the address has a UK type post code.

So my question is do I just post as normal using say SPECIAL DELIVERY or do I have to use INTERNATIONAL POSTAGE as it is not on the main land??

Yup - UK.

Some companies try to hike their postage costs my having UK rates for 'mainland' UK only - so excluding Ireland, Channel Isles, Shetland Isles, Hebredies etc...

... but if it's got a UK postcode then it's a UK delivery, so no need to use International Signed for.
(Though I think you do for anything going to Falklands, Gibralter etc)

Falklands, Gibraltar are 2 of 14 British Overseas Territories whereas Jersey, Guernsey and the Isle of Man are Crown dependencies rather than Overseas Territories.
